Overview

The Israel Innovation Authority is an independent statutory public entity responsible for formulating and executing Israel's innovation policy. Its mission is to strengthen the innovation ecosystem and promote innovation, entrepreneurship, and disruptive technologies as levers for inclusive and sustainable economic growth. The Authority provides conditional grants to support disruptive technological innovations and engages in creating the groundwork and infrastructure to prepare for future technologies, aiming to maintain both technological and economic leadership and improve productivity and global competitiveness of the Israeli economy. The Authority operates through various divisions, including the Innovation Infrastructure Division, which supports research infrastructures and breakthrough technologies; the Startup Division, which assists entrepreneurs in developing new technological ideas into products; the Growth and Advanced Manufacturing Division, which helps companies grow through technological innovation; and the International Collaborations Division, which supports Israeli companies in entering international markets by financing R&D collaborations with foreign companies. Additionally, the ISERD division supports the participation of Israeli companies in European Union framework programs. By offering a variety of practical tools and funding platforms, the Israel Innovation Authority addresses the dynamic and changing needs of the local and international innovation ecosystems. Its efforts contribute to the advancement of Israel's knowledge-based science and technology industries, encouraging innovation and entrepreneurship while stimulating economic growth.
